Bitcoin Price Struggles Below $95.6K Triple Top — India Hype vs. ETF Drag

Bitcoin is stuck in a holding pattern just below a key resistance at $95,643, forming what looks like a triple top on the chart. While technical signals flash indecision, the broader market is split between bullish momentum coming from India’s $10 million crypto push and the drag from continued ETF delays in the U.S.

The $95.6K ceiling is now the battleground, and a breakout — or breakdown — could set the tone for the next big move.

India’s Crypto Boom Fuels Bitcoin Optimism

In a contrasting bright spot, India is emerging as a powerhouse for Web3 development. Bitget and Avalanche are investing $10 million to grow India’s crypto talent pipeline through events, grants, and scholarships — with a focus on Delhi and Bangalore.

  • 75% of Indian crypto investors are aged 18–35
  • India supplies 12% of global Web3 devs
  • Coinbase and Bybit are returning to the Indian market

The move could boost adoption of major assets like BTC, especially as regulatory clarity improves. While Dogecoin and SHIB draw headlines, BTC and ETH remain dominant holdings in India’s maturing investor base.

Trump Token Buzz, ETF Delays Stir Uncertainty

On the U.S. front, Trump’s Truth Social is exploring its own crypto token to support subscriptions and digital services. While the news hasn’t moved DJT stock much, it reflects rising mainstream interest in blockchain solutions.

Meanwhile, the SEC has again delayed decisions on Dogecoin and XRP ETFs proposed by Bitwise and Franklin Templeton — pushing them to June. This follows over 70 pending crypto ETF proposals submitted in 2025.

Key Highlights:

  • Trump token may boost mainstream crypto appeal
  • ETF delays favor BTC over altcoins
  • Political pressure on regulators is rising

These developments reinforce BTC’s positioning as the safest bet for institutional inflows, especially as uncertainty swirls around altcoin regulation.

Bitcoin (BTC/USD) Technical Outlook – Trade Setup Below $95K

The BTC/USD is showing signs of exhaustion just beneath the $95,643 resistance zone. Price action has repeatedly tested this level but failed to break through, forming a potential double-top pattern.

The 50 EMA ($94,698) is now acting as near-term resistance, while the ascending trendline from April 24 continues to offer support. MACD momentum is flattening, signaling indecision.

For traders: this is a classic range-trading scenario. If BTC fails to reclaim $95,643 and dips toward $93,760, traders could look to buy near the trendline with a stop below $93,000.

Alternatively, a clean breakout above $95,643 on strong volume opens the door to $96,850. Until then, expect choppy sideways action.
